Firmware channel runbook — Emberline devices. New folks: updates flow stable → beta → canary, never skipped. Push only from the channel console. Verify checksum match before promoting a build. If a rollout stalls past 20%, halt and page the on-call. The console authenticates to the internal channel broker with this key:

service key, fawip-bajef: kto11_Qt5wZK9vdNC

Meeting notes, Thursday stand-up — warehouse shift leads. Quarterly stock-count ledger for Drayfell Supply is now closed and reconciled; variance under half a percent, mostly in the fasteners aisle. Orvin will print the signed summary and bind the ledger by Friday noon. Head office at Marwick Row wants the original, not a copy, carried over by courier next week. The confidential hand-over instruction for that courier appears directly below.

drop instructions, baduf-yajof: the fraius norius courier leaves the lamox ledger at gate 5992 under passcode 336459

Onboarding note for the Ledgerpane admin table: bulk edits are applied through the batcher service, not directly against the database. Select rows, choose an action, and the batcher stages changes in a pending set you can review before commit. Edits over 500 rows require a second approver — this is enforced server-side, so don't try to chunk around it. To run the batcher locally you need the staging write credential, which goes in your .env as the next line.

secret setting of bahip-kagag: RELAY_SECRET3=c83

This page summarises Verdanti Group's Q2 cash-flow forecast for the board. Operating inflows are projected at a 6% increase over Q1, led by the Brellan contract renewals. Capital outflows peak in May with the Fenwright facility upgrade. Net position remains positive throughout, though the buffer narrows in June before recovering. Assumptions: stable receivables at 42 days, no early drawdown of the Tarnell credit line. The board should read this forecast alongside the strategic remark set out directly below.

internal memo for fajog-yagaf: Gross margin on Ulaael came in at 20 percent against a plan of 10 percent. Only 9 of the 80 pilot accounts renewed Ulaael, so a churn review is set for July 1.